The Social Security (Overpayments and Recovery)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2016

Employer to notify liable person of deductionN.I.

This section has no associated Explanatory Memorandum

20.—(1) An employer making a deduction from earnings for the purpose of these Regulations must notify the liable person in writing of the amount of the deduction including any amount deducted for administrative costs under regulation 19(11).

(2) Such notification must be given or sent not later than the pay-day on which the deduction is made or, where that is impracticable, not later than the following pay-day.

(3) An employer must, within 28 days of receiving a written request from the liable person, provide that person with an explanation in writing of how the first amount referred to in paragraph (1) was calculated.
